Background of Sustainability Trends in Swimwear and Surf Culture
Over recent years, the swimwear industry has seen a rising demand for sustainable products, driven by increased awareness of ocean pollution and environmental impact. Brands have begun adopting recycled fabrics, biodegradable materials, and transparent supply chains. Simultaneously, surf culture has historically emphasized respect for the ocean, making it a natural fit for collaborations focused on ocean conservation. Several brands have previously launched eco-friendly collections, but surf-informed collaborations are now gaining prominence as a dedicated niche within this movement.
This trend aligns with broader environmental initiatives and consumer preferences, with some companies partnering with ocean conservation organizations to raise awareness and funds. The upcoming collaborations build on this momentum, promising to combine style, performance, and sustainability.
